Key Features of Horizontal Baler Machines
One of the key features of horizontal balers is their ability to process materials continuously. This is particularly useful in facilities where waste is generated throughout the day, such as distribution centres or manufacturing plants.
Horizontal baler machines are designed for high-volume use. Their structure allows substantial material throughput without frequent interruptions, helping to maintain workflow efficiency.
Many machines include automated functions such as auto-tying systems and programmable controls. These reduce manual involvement and help maintain consistent bale quality. Although horizontal balers take up more space than vertical units, they are ideal for sites with sufficient space. Their layout often integrates with conveyor systems for improved efficiency.

Choosing the Right Horizontal Baler
Selecting a suitable baler requires careful consideration of site needs, including:
- Material output: Assess daily waste levels to match machine capacity.
- Material type: Different materials require different compression levels.
- Automation requirements: Some operations benefit from fully automated systems.
- System integration: Consider compatibility with conveyors or other systems.
A well-matched horizontal baler supports long-term efficiency without adding unnecessary complexity.
Maintenance and Operational Considerations
Routine maintenance is essential for reliable performance. Inspecting hydraulic systems, cutting components, and tying mechanisms can reduce the risk of downtime.
Staff should be properly trained to ensure safe and effective use. This includes understanding loading methods, monitoring bale formation, and identifying early issues.
